Our analysis found Art Center College of Design to be the best school for graphic communications students who want to pursue a bachelor’s degree in the United States. Located in the city of Pasadena, Art Center College of Design is a private not-for-profit college with a small student population.

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end Illinois State University. It ranked #5 on our 2023 Best Graphic Communications Bachelor’s Degree Schools list. Located in the medium-sized suburb of Normal, Illinois State is a public school with a fairly large student population.

Rochester Institute of Technology came in at #6 in this year’s edition of the Best Graphic Communications Bachelor’s Degree Schools ranking. RIT is a large private not-for-profit school located in the large suburb of Rochester.
The average amount in student loans that graphic communication majors at RIT take out while working on their Bachelor's Degree is $25,271.
